Output 58983b7f854a96e66b5142b9c9d3bb3005e7671070a610e030bddf352a8ae61d:0

value
235309
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c29d2220f219c04cf6b9ecf67c64f35ec7a3a8a OP_EQUALVERIFY OP_CHECKSIG
address
1FEiWgu89TV9Dkqx6D2YK4hAeuYbJge956
transaction
58983b7f854a96e66b5142b9c9d3bb3005e7671070a610e030bddf352a8ae61d
spent
true